VCAT Hearing - Mrs Gaita Pullicino

24 April 2015
Logo

On 23 April 2015, the Victorian Civil and Administrative Tribunal (VCAT) continued the hearing of a part heard review application of Mrs Gaita Pullicino.  The review application was in relation to a decision of the HRV Stewards to cancel the training and driving licences of Mrs Pullicino as a result of an alleged breach of a condition attached to Mrs Pullicino’s licence relating to a stable inspection conducted by HRV Stewards in September 2014 concerning the amount of horses on the property of Mrs Pullicino.  After considering all of the evidence and the submissions of the legal representatives of Mrs Pullicino and the HRV Stewards, the Tribunal dismissed Mrs Pullicino’s application, affirming that the HRV Stewards were entitled to cancel the licences of Mrs Pullicino in the circumstances.  As a result of this decision, Mrs Pullicino, who had been operating on a stay of proceedings since 31 October 2014, is not the holder of a current licence and horses nominated for upcoming meetings have been scratched accordingly.
